What Are Flicker-Free Lights?
Flicker-free lights are lighting systems designed to eliminate the rapid fluctuations in brightness that occur with some types of LED lights. Flicker is usually caused by the power supply or dimming circuitry, and while it may not be noticeable to the naked eye, it can cause eye strain, headaches, or even affect concentration. Flicker-free lights use advanced technology, such as high-quality drivers and stabilised current, to ensure that the light output is constant and smooth, without any perceptible flicker. This results in a more comfortable and healthier lighting environment.

How Can I Tell if an LED Light is Flicker-Free?
Identifying whether an LED light like a suspended LED light is flicker-free involves looking for specific labels or certifications. Manufacturers often indicate "flicker-free" or "low flicker" in the product specifications or packaging. Another method is to check the LED light's driver type; more advanced drivers generally help reduce flicker. Additionally, performing a test with a camera or smartphone can reveal flickering, as some phones and cameras can detect flicker that is otherwise invisible to the human eye. It's also a good idea to read reviews or consult with the manufacturer to confirm the light’s performance before purchasing.
Are Flicker-Free LED Lights Energy Efficient?
Yes, flicker-free LED lights are energy efficient. Like standard LEDs, they use much less energy compared to traditional incandescent or fluorescent lighting, offering long-lasting performance and lower electricity consumption. The technology used in flicker-free LEDs ensures that the light is more stable, which can reduce wasted energy from inefficient light output or flickering. Additionally, many flicker-free LED lights are designed with energy-saving features such as dimming capabilities, allowing for further energy reduction in various environments. As a result, they are an excellent choice for both commercial and residential applications looking to reduce energy costs.
